1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is evaporation?
Back
Evaporation is the process by which water turns into water vapor (gas) when it is heated, usually by the sun.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is condensation?
Back
Condensation is the process by which water vapor cools and changes back into liquid water, forming clouds.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is precipitation?
Back
Precipitation is any form of water, such as rain, snow, sleet, or hail, that falls from clouds to the Earth's surface.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What role does the sun play in the water cycle?
Back
The sun is the driving force of the Earth's weather and the water cycle, providing the energy needed for evaporation.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is transpiration?
Back
Transpiration is the process by which plants release water vapor into the air through small openings in their leaves.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is water vapor?
Back
Water vapor is the gaseous state of water that is present in the atmosphere and is a key component of the water cycle.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How do clouds form?
Back
Clouds form when water vapor in the air cools and condenses into tiny water droplets or ice crystals.
